FC Barcelona is the third Spanish club most affected by injuries during 2024-25. A study conducted by HONOR revealed that the Catalans have suffered 14 injuries between August 2024 and January 2025, coinciding with the forecasts expected by experts before the start of the season. Meanwhile, Real Madrid and Athletic Club (16 injuries) also appear among the 25 teams most affected by physical problems in the first half of 2024-25.

In this regard, HONOR's research warns that, despite the injuries, the three Spanish clubs have managed to maintain their performance in LaLiga compared to the previous season. Madrid has maintained the lead, while Barcelona, which was third at the end of the first half in 2023-24, also remains in the same position at this point in the calendar. The same goes for the Basque team, fourth in contention at the end of January in both campaigns.

Barcelona is the 25th team with the most injuries in 2024-25

According to the authors of the study, conducted with the support of the University of Oxford, clubs lose, on average, 1 point in their respective leagues for every 177 days of injury, while every 542 days of absence translates into the loss of a position in the standings. Among the 14 injuries suffered by the Blaugrana squad, the most serious have been those of Marc Bernal and Marc-André ter Stegen, both ruled out until next summer. Next is Andreas Christensen, whose physical problems have barely allowed him to play one league match.

So far, the Catalans are the twenty-fifth European club that has suffered the most in 2024-25 due to injuries. Athletic and Madrid follow in the rankings at positions 15 and 16, respectively. RB Salzburg leads the ranking of clubs affected by physical problems, with 22 injuries, two more than the Italian Genoa (20) and ahead of the English Brighton and Arsenal (both with 18).
